Reuters: China Tells G20 To Keep Its Hands Off The Yuan
China told the rest
of the world on Friday not to meddle with the way it manages the yuan,
calling the exchange rate a sovereign matter for it alone to decide.
Beijing is under pressure from Washington in particular to let the yuan rise in value to help reduce the large U.S. trade deficit with China, and markets are expecting the issue to come up at next week's Group of 20 summit in Canada.
